About the role

Responsibilities

  • Design, build, and support automation solutions using Power Automate, Power Apps, AI agents, and OneTrust
  • Develop end-to-end workflow automations including email, API, and file-based processes
  • Build automations using Python, Azure Logic Apps, and related technologies
  • Design and maintain dashboards using Power BI and Power Platform
  • Perform data validation, cleansing, and quality checks for reporting solutions
  • Support surveillance tools from a functionality and analytics perspective
  • Partner with Compliance SMEs to convert business requirements into technical solutions
  • Maintain process documentation, reference guides, and automation inventories

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Data Analytics, Information Systems, Engineering, or a related field
  • 3-5 years of experience in automation, dashboard design, data validation, and analytics
  • Strong proficiency in Python and SQL
  • Strong experience with data visualization tools such as Power BI or Tableau
  • Knowledge of AI/ML techniques including anomaly detection, NLP, and predictive analytics
  • Experience with automation tools such as Power Automate, Alteryx, or UiPath

Preferred Qualifications

  • Certifications in data analytics or visualization tools
  • Exposure to AI, machine learning, or data science certifications
  • Experience or certification in AI prompt engineering
  • Working knowledge of APIs, data pipelines, and system integrations
